About Nearfield Instruments
Nearfield Instruments (NFI) is a fast-growing scale-up high-tech company. We design, develop, integrate, market and service advanced metrology machines. Our machines enables our customers - the world’s leading chipmakers – to increase the production yields, and thus, functionality of their microchips, which in turn leads to smaller, more powerful consumer electronics.
Founded in 2016, we bring together the most creative minds (approx. 380 employees) in science and technology and develop a one-of-a-kind, revolutionary high throughput Scanning Probe Microscopy system.
What will you be doing?
As a key leader in our Qualification and Testing activities, you will guide a team of AIT, Test and Qualification engineers and technicians working on our state-of-the-art semiconductor metrology systems in our ISO 5 cleanroom and laboratories. Your mission is to ensure that every integrated system meets the highest standards of performance, reliability and quality before reaching our customers.
Main responsibilities include:
Build and lead a strong Qualification and Test team, ensuring a safe, structured and high-performing cleanroom environment.
Plan, oversee and execute qualification and testing activities to verify system functionality, performance, efficiency and reliability.
Develop test strategies, oversee test execution, review and analyse results, and implement corrective or preventive actions when needed.
Ensure the successful completion of the qualification phase (Stage 5) and Factory Acceptance Test in line with customer specifications and expectations.
Collaborate closely with cross-functional teams such as design, development, supply chain and production to align on planning, technical integration and resource needs.
Continuously evaluate and improve qualification and integration processes, tools and methodologies to enhance quality, cycle time and operational efficiency.
Manage capacity and resource planning to align team assignments with the Master Production Plan and delivery timelines.
Ensure full documentation and traceability of all qualification processes, results and deviations in accordance with industry and organizational standards.
Identify potential technical and planning risks early and develop effective mitigation strategies.
Contribute to system design reviews and development discussions to make sure qualification requirements are built in from the start.
Oversee budgeting, cost estimation and resource allocation for qualification and FAT activities, ensuring optimal use of people and resources.
